Novel

Livestreaming trash picking has made me a regular at the police station.

Chapter 1: Reborn with a System

Li City.

A remote alley.

A person was squatting at the entrance of the alley, eyes fixed on the trash can ahead with an eager expression, secretly rubbing their fists. A stray dog passing by was so frightened that it stumbled backward and bolted away.

Huh, where did this crazy woman come from in broad daylight?

"Jiang Xiaoya, there's no one around right now. Hurry up and go rummage through the trash can. If this keeps up, forget about completing the mission—if you faint from hunger again, our show is going to be delayed."

Through the "Sky Eye" earpiece she was wearing, the assistant producer was forced to speak up.

Listening to the assistant producer's urging, Jiang Xiaoya knew that this live-streaming Sky Eye device was waterproof, heat-resistant, and connected directly to the live broadcast room. Needless to say, the netizens in the chat must be hurling insults again. She looked at the group of stray dogs in the distance, baring their teeth and eyeing her covetously, and let out a long howl toward the sky: "Stop urging me! I'm about to snatch food from the dog's mouth right now!"

This is truly absurd, like absurdity opening the door for absurdity—absurdity has reached its peak.

In her previous life, she was the only daughter of a famous self-made billionaire, a proper second-generation rich kid. Who would have thought her starting point after rebirth would be such trash.

The original owner had a miserable life story: she couldn't find a job after graduating from college, so she signed up for a national variety show focused on competition among the lower social classes. Logically, with such a miserable background, she shouldn't have been so timid, but reality is just that dramatic. The original owner lacked the resilient qualities of someone from a poor family and instead suffered from the common flaws of low self-esteem and sensitivity. In three days, let alone winning a ranking, she couldn't even scrape together money for food and had actually 'fainted' from hunger.

Never mind the show's ranking; Jiang Xiaoya knew that if she didn't dig something up, she would soon follow in the original owner's footsteps and ascend to heaven.

Literally starve to death!

Jiang Xiaoya seemed to have made up her mind. She clenched her fists and initiated her food-snatching plan.

She picked up a red brick from under her feet, weighed it in her hand, and suddenly charged toward the trash can across the street, coincidentally bumping into the large black dog that had been waiting for its chance and slowly approaching the bin.

The large black dog seemed startled by the madwoman who suddenly lunged out; it stumbled violently and retreated, baring its teeth.

Startled, Jiang Xiaoya stepped back, tripped over a stone, and landed hard on her butt.

The large black dog: "..."

Netizens in the live stream: "..."

After a brief silence, the comments flew by.

【What a loser! You've got a brick, what are you afraid of?!】

【Is she scared stupid?】

【First time I've seen a dog look at an idiot like that...】

【From the moment I first saw this stream, I was attracted by the aura of stupidity on her. The second day she wandered around a few streets, I bet she was a dark horse. The third day she starved herself unconscious, giving little old me a huge shock. Just when I thought her potential was finally being triggered and she was bound to rise, sigh... she should have just starved to death earlier.】

【How did the production team recruit someone like this? Aren't they afraid something will actually happen?】

【It's a competitive survival show, they signed contracts, don't worry.】

【Where did this idiot come from?】

However, the reason Jiang Xiaoya didn't immediately get up to fight was that she had awakened a system!!

【Ding, system is detecting the environment.】

【Detection successful.】

【Activating Social Work Skills System!】

【Activation successful!】

Jiang Xiaoya was immersed in the joy and confusion of obtaining a system.

She carefully examined the newly acquired system.

【Social Work Skills System.】

The gloomy mood she felt just moments ago due to her low starting point vanished instantly. Her expression became excited, sweeping away the frantic and lost image she had just projected.

How does that saying go? When you're sleepy, someone brings a pillow; before you starve to death, the God of Wealth brings you a rice bowl.

【Ding, detected host's occupation as... Scavenger.】

【Reward skill: Detection.】

【System tasks use a point system; points can be exchanged for gifts. Scavenging can also lead to wealth, host, hurry up and take action.】

Detection?

As Jiang Xiaoya pondered how to use this skill, her eyes inadvertently swept over the trash can across the street.

She saw that the originally green trash can was now covered in a faint, red, mist-like layer.

At the same time, a system alert sounded in her mind.

【Ding, valuable item detected, valuable item detected...】

Jiang Xiaoya's eyes instantly burst with light. She threw away the brick in her hand, scrambled up from the ground, and charged toward the street across from her.

The large black dog was so scared by the person who had suddenly gone crazy that it ran away.

The netizens in the live stream were all "WTF."

【Is she changing careers to staged accidents because she can't find trash?】

【666, what a genius, why didn't I think of that?】

【Is she...!!! Planning to pull up the trash can and sell it for money?!!】

【This is a big deal. We told her to pick up trash, not commit crimes.】

【The trash can is public property. Does she have a brain?】

【If she had a brain, would she have starved herself unconscious?】

【She must be starved crazy.】

At first, Jiang Xiaoya was very patient, leaning over the trash can to rummage, but she couldn't reach the bottom. In a fit of anger, she pulled the trash can over and dumped everything inside out.

Her mind was filled with the "valuable item" the system mentioned. Seeing a black plastic bag at the bottom, she felt like she had found a treasure and quickly stepped forward to untie it.

I'm rich, I'm rich, I'm really rich this time.

"Goodbye, mother, I'm setting sail tonight. Don't worry about me, I have the oars of happiness and wisdom... AHHH!!!!"

The netizens in the live stream, hearing the woman suddenly start singing in an inexplicable tune, were all speechless. Then, with her sudden scream, everyone in the chat covered their ears in unison.

【My mom asked if I have some kind of serious illness for watching this retard.】

【Hahaha, what is she singing? It's hilarious.】

【The crazy woman is scaring herself. There is no craziest, only crazier.】

【Wait, look closely at what fell on the ground.】

【Black hair, red blood... is that a human head??!!!】

【AH!!!!!!】

The plastic bag in Jiang Xiaoya's hand dropped. The head inside rolled to her feet, its eyeballs staring fixedly upward at her. Jiang Xiaoya let out another scream.

She must have bound to a prank system. This is deadly, damn it!!

Jiang Xiaoya couldn't care about her foul-smelling fingertips; she tremblingly took out her phone, which had only one bar of battery left, and dialed the police.

"Hello, Officer, I want to turn in a head. Pfft, not my head, someone else's head. I didn't kill anyone, but the head is in my hands... sigh, it's hard to explain. Anyway, hurry over here, someone's dead."

In less than half an hour, the news of someone live-streaming the discovery of a human head hit the trending searches. Netizens flooded into the live stream upon hearing the news, crowding the front row to watch the crime scene.

The police arrived quickly, cordoned off the scene, and detained Jiang Xiaoya to take her back for a statement.

At first, Jiang Xiaoya refused to go. She had just been reborn and hadn't experienced a good life yet; she didn't want to be labeled a suspect.

But when she heard the officers whispering about how this might be the bounty task their bureau had just released—finding human remains would earn a reward—she immediately agreed and went with them without another word.
